Mumbai, 06 Aug (HS): Replying to allegations by MLA Rohit Pawar against Chief

Minister Devendra Fadnavis, BJP Spokesperson Navnath Ban said that that the

bridge in Gadchiroli that collapsed was constructed during the tenure of Uddhav

Thackeray as Chief Minister. The bridge after three years of construction

collapsed during the heavy rain. Rohit Pawar on his X account alleged that the

bridge was inaugurated by Fadnavis, collapsed within three years of

construction. He also alleged of brokerage was taken by Fadnavis-led rulers.

Ban

stated that the bridge was constructed in 2022, when Uddhav Thackeray was the

Chief Minister. Pawar of NCP (Sharad Pawar) should ask him about the commission

he had taken. NCP (SP) was a partner in the MVA government at that time.

Ban

also alleged Uddhav Thackeray of partnering with Congress for power, against

the principles of Shiv Sena Founder Balasaheb Thackeray.

UBT

leader Sanjay Raut is also levelling illogical allegations, Bun said and added

that he should instead keep his mouth shut and introspect. People of

Maharashtra have shown UBT their place.
